At the hall of Assembly of the Left wing pack, Cain sat high on his throne, the elders standing below in rows of four- two rows by Cain's left and two by his left. A long red fur carpet seperating them.

Cain had summoned a meeting at the late house

An elder stepped forward, his head bowed slightly. "Alpha, the pack has been under stability all thanks to your wisdom and graceful leading the people have been very thankful for that. But..." he paused.

Cain raised a brow. "What's the matter?"

The elder looked at him contemplating on whether to continue, but he pushed forward with what he had started. "Alpha Kael has stopped the supply for the essentials required by the pack members of Left wing."

Cain hit his fist angrily at the armrest of his throne. "What do you mean by that?"

"It is just has I have said. Right wing of New moon pack Controls the receiving and the supply of our essentials like food, clothing etc, but for the past one week, we haven't received anything but flimsy excuses."

Cain frown, thick line appearing between his brow, a muscle in his jaw twitched and his lips slowly drew back in a snarl.

"If it continues like this, the pack members will live in huge poverty." Another elder chipped in.

"I will take care of it. My people won't suffer." Cain vowed, though his brows were still knitted.

Elder Mako stepped forward- the oldest Elder in the left wing. "Alpha Cain, I believe I speak on behalf of some elders when I say Luna Aria is no longer worthy to be called Luna."

Few members gasped at what he had just sprouted out while others nodded in agreement.

But Cain, he just simply kept his cool, even thought he was boiling in rage inwardly. He wanted to come down the throne and snap his neck instantly for calling his mate unworthy.

To contain all the fury, he just simply clenched his two fist, his nails digging into his palm and his knuckles turning white.

"Any why is that?" he asked, voice calm.

"It is now a known fact that the Luna keeps going unconscious every now and then. Everyone of us knew for a fact that she is a wolfless weak omega but we accepted her because you wanted her, but if she continues to display that she is weak, I suggest you take in another Luna."

The supporting elders nodded while the others snarled in disapproval.

"How about you take Princess Maida into consideration. She is from the bloodline of Alpha's and she will make a good leader. Moreover you both have been friends since childhood." Another elder suggested.

Cain lost his cool facade he had been trying to show and he let out a loud spine shivering growl. "Enough!!!!!"

"I will take no other Luna in except Aria. And anyone who speaks of this is considered a threat and a rebel to the pack. I'm sure you all know the consequences of rebellion."

The air inside the ruined stone house was thick and heavy with burning incense.

The old seer sat before a shallow fire pit, bones and carved stones arranged in a precise circle around him. Though he had lost his powers after it had been stripped off by the moon goddess, he could still perform dark rituals as it was recorded in a book by the first seer to ever exist.

"Alpha Kael, you want to break a bond blessed by the Moon Goddess," the seer said slowly. "I'm sure you certainly do understand what you are asking?”

Kael stepped forward, his presence commanding, cold. "Yes, I just simply want what was stolen from me.”

The seer chuckled, a dry, broken sound. "Stolen? What a nice word to use to balance the ego in you." he muttered then closed his eyes.

Kael's jaw tightened. "Watch your mouth!'

"This ritual will not restore your bond. It will corrupt hers. It will make her lose control of her wolf."

Kael’s eyes darkened. "I don't give a flying f*ck about it, so far she is mine."

The seer leaned forward, his eyes still closed. "Only Aria's wolf want you. That is to say, her head what you, but her heart says otherwise. If I help in the forceful awakening of her wolf, it will reject the claimed bond and crawl back to the first mark it ever knew."

Tharren stiffened behind them. "That could kill her."

The seer nodded. "It would cause the pack fall."

Kael didn’t blink. "She mustn't die. You have to do something about that." he sneaked.

The seer smiled slowly. "You blood will be needed for the binding and when it is done, you will stand alone to bear the consequences of your action.0"

Kael extended his palm. "Do it."

The fire flared violently, shadows crawling up the walls like living things.

Tharren walked out with clenched fist since he couldn't bear watching it.

"Then know this,"the seer said, carving a symbol into the dirt. "Once the ritual begins, Cain will feel it. Aria will also feel it, she will bleed as her wolf tries to forcefully come out. And when her wolf does… Alpha Cain will fall."

Kael’s lips curved into a dangerous smile. "Let the ritual begin."

The old seer cut his palm with a sharp knife, collecting it in a bowl.

He began the ritual with several incantation flowing out of his mouth.

Night had already settled over the pack. Cain sat alone by the window in his chamber staring at the dark forest that extended far beyond his eyes could see.

Aria was in the bathroom freshening up when he suddenly had her scream in pain.

"Aria!" he called out standing up from where he sat to go meet her.

Suddenly, he felt something slam into his chest like a violent pulse, sharp and sudden.

Cain stiffened, his eyes going dark immediately. "Aria!" he whispered, one hand clutched to his chest and the other instinctively reaching out to the door which was still some steps away from him.

In the bathroom, Aria had had already slumped to the ground unconscious, but her body still wriggled as her wolf tried forcing it way out.

"He is calling me." her wolf kept whispering.

He began feeling weak and each time he tired to take a step forward amidst the pain, his leg wobbled till it finally gave in. His knees reached the ground with a thud.

The red thread of fate between him began to feel so fragile. The connection was there, but distorted. Like the thread of fate was l being pulled too tight with the hope of breaking it.

His jaw clenched, his wolf began to stir uncomfortably from within him. The pain increased, sharp and unbearable. He couldn't move. He couldn't feel himself.

Then a sudden realization hit him, this was Aria's awakening.

At that moment Cain felt it- a second presence.

Someone else was touching the bond.

Cain’s breath came slow and heavy, but his eyes burned with fury. "Kael," he growled under his breath, the name tasting like poison in his mouth.

At that moment he went unconscious.
